Europe - Clash of Nations - 22 Players
A new scenario is available for 22 generals to trail their strengths within the same territory as the existing map. Nations are evenly balanced, but tighter together resulting in a charged and more intensive mood.
Attached are all the details:
-Release of an entire new map: Europe for 22 players.
-Implementation of new map design and game graphics.
-Improvement of the resource balancing for the 10 player map Europe1932.
-Units which are embarking or disembarking are now vulnerable to both land and sea damage.
-Units which are changing sides after a revolt now have the same level that was already researched by the new owner.
-Rocket attacks now get an own article in the newspaper.
-Reduced the ranking points for cheap level 1 buildings.
-Normalized the ranking points for units (increased points for cheap units, reduced points for expensive units).
-Fixed a bug where armies could not be unified.
-Fixed a bug where diplomatic conversations did not update.
-Fixed a bug where the layout of the espionage list was broken.
-Improvement of server processes.
